Agile QA Unpacked: Software Principles Meet Medical Precision
Agile QA thrives on short, iterative sprints—typically 2-4 weeks—delivering testable increments. In healthcare, this looks like a trauma team prototyping a triage protocol, testing it in simulations, gathering paramedic feedback, and refining it swiftly. Full-stack QA frameworks, which cover automation tools, DevOps integration, and programming basics, offer a model for a “full-stack” healthcare ecosystem—spanning EHR audits, device testing, and post-market surveillance.
Surprising stat: Agile adopters resolve issues 30% faster, cutting costs and boosting transparency. Insider tip: Use “shift-left” testing to catch flaws early, like AI diagnostic biases, aligning with ECRI’s 2025 call for stronger AI governance. Automate regression tests for devices with Python scripts, mirroring software’s Selenium, to ensure FDA compliance without bottlenecks. Real-World Success: Case Studies Proving Agile’s Impact
Stories bring agile’s power to life. In 2025, a U.S. healthcare network revamped telehealth deployment. Legacy procurement lagged for months, but agile’s modular contracts—built on frequent stakeholder feedback—cut rollout times by 50% and strengthened cybersecurity QA for patient data. This addresses traditional QA’s siloed flaws, fostering collaboration.
In Italy, a pediatric hospital adopted Agile Six Sigma, holding weekly retrospectives to tackle ER bottlenecks. Results? Wait times dropped 25%, and medication errors fell 35%, showcasing continuous improvement’s strength. Inspired by full-stack QA’s project-based approach, they used tools like Jira to track “user stories,” adapting software practices for healthcare compliance.
A 2025 Boston medtech firm’s AI pacemaker project stands out: traditional validation took 18 months, but agile sprints with clinician feedback secured FDA clearance in 9 months, with 20% fewer recalls. These cases highlight agile’s ability to bridge legacy gaps, prioritizing patient safety through rapid iterations.
Your Agile Playbook: Actionable Steps to Transform QA
Implement agile with these practical, full-stack-inspired tips:
- Form Cross-Functional Pods: Launch daily 15-minute stand-ups with clinicians, IT, and admins. Use tools like Trello to track “user stories,” e.g., “As a nurse, I need real-time IV pump alerts to prevent dosing errors.”
- Automate Early: Script automated tests for devices (e.g., Python for ventilator settings), cutting manual errors by 60%. Start with a sprint auditing EHR flags to prevent gaslighting risks.
- Hold Retrospectives: Post-shift, ask: “What worked? What needs tweaking?” This caught a chemotherapy dosing flaw in one hospital, protecting 200 patients.
- Upskill with Agile Training: Programs emphasizing automation and real-time projects equip teams for HIPAA-compliant workflows, addressing skill gaps in healthcare QA.
